Output e32b60f142aa2d462ee8f58cacc1e2ed439dcf8e97d34a5bfba2a3a3ad1aae16:0

value
168979200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e71c74a2b7b93a50293a40c66994aca9dd75454b OP_EQUALVERIFY OP_CHECKSIG
address
1N51BShfi9zF69eaNhqW4dswKCyjzGF8Ba
transaction
e32b60f142aa2d462ee8f58cacc1e2ed439dcf8e97d34a5bfba2a3a3ad1aae16
confirmations
489290
spent
true